Taylor Townsend returns a ball to Aryna Sabalenka of Belarus in the fourth round of the US Open in Arthur Ashe Stadium at the US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center on Sunday, Sept. Before taking on world No. 1 Aryna Sabalenka in the fourth round of the US Open, Townsend emerged in a floor-length black hooded coat covered in layers of shimmering fringe.
